From 0de704a27647b37c26fc1b40af5e45c58d3bc172 Mon Sep 17 00:00:00 2001 From: Weijia Wang <9713184+wegank@users.noreply.github.com> Date: Thu, 25 May 2023 16:23:54 +0300 Subject: [PATCH] python311Packages.scikit-misc: 0.1.4 -> 0.2.0 --- .../python-modules/scikit-misc/default.nix | 28 +++++++++++-------- 1 file changed, 17 insertions(+), 11 deletions(-) diff --git a/pkgs/development/python-modules/scikit-misc/default.nix b/pkgs/development/python-modules/scikit-misc/default.nix index ab37bdfd7e9..fa35fbd9ed9 100644 --- a/pkgs/development/python-modules/scikit-misc/default.nix +++ b/pkgs/development/python-modules/scikit-misc/default.nix @@ -3,35 +3,41 @@ , buildPythonPackage , cython , gfortran -, pytestCheckHook -, numpy }: +, git +, meson-python +, pkg-config +, numpy +, openblas +}: buildPythonPackage rec { pname = "scikit-misc"; - version = "0.1.4"; + version = "0.2.0"; + format = "pyproject"; src = fetchPypi { - inherit pname version; - hash = "sha256-93RqA0eBEGPh7PkSHflINXhQA5U8OLW6hPY/xQjCKRE="; + pname = "scikit_misc"; + inherit version; + hash = "sha256-rBTdTpNeRC/DSrHFg7ZhHUYD0G9IgoqFx+A+LCxYK7w="; }; postPatch = '' - substituteInPlace pytest.ini \ - --replace "--cov --cov-report=xml" "" + patchShebangs . ''; nativeBuildInputs = [ + cython gfortran + git + meson-python + pkg-config ]; buildInputs = [ - cython numpy + openblas ]; - # Tests fail because of infinite recursion error - doCheck = false; - pythonImportsCheck = [ "skmisc" ];